Classic STAR - Situation, Task, Action, Result - is solid, but most candidates ramble through the setup and rush the result. Here's the upgrade.
Lead with the result
Interviewers decide fast whether your story is going somewhere. Open with the outcome, then rewind: "I cut our release time in half - here's how."
Rebalance your time
- Situation + Task: 1-2 lines. Just enough context.
- Action: 60% of your answer - this is what they're assessing.
- Result: a concrete metric, plus what you learned.
Prepare 5 flexible stories
You don't need 20 answers. Prepare five strong stories - a win, a conflict, a failure, leadership, and pressure - and adapt them to whatever's asked.
